BARRAGES OF BALLOONS
LONDON’S AIR DEFENCE CONSTRUCTION PLANS (British Official Wireless.) Reed 9.30 a.m. ' RUGBY, Feb. 12. It is announced that plans have been made by the Air Ministry for the manufacture, at the Royal airship works, Cardington, near Bedford, of a certain number of balloons for use i the balloon barrages which form part of the air defence of London. Since the construction of airships was discontinued at Cardington, the establishment there has been maintained on a skeleton basis.
